John Smith

John holds ASL Teacher certification from the American Sign Language Teachers Association. He has taught American Sign Language and Deaf Culture to professional service providers, high school students, children, and interested adult learners for more than thirty years. A graduate of Gallaudet University, John's experience regarding the use of ASL in the English-speaking classroom, designing ASL curricula, and developing ASL training programs is comprehensive. John's graduate studies focus on Deaf education and Deaf culture with a specialization in visual learning.
